드론 군집 통신 모듈 시장 규모는 최근 급속히 확대하고 있습니다. 2025년 14억 4,000만 달러에서 2026년에는 17억 1,000만 달러로, CAGR 18.8%로 성장할 것으로 전망되고 있습니다. 지난 수년간의 성장 요인으로는 저지연 무선통신 기술의 발전, 감시 및 매핑 용도로의 드론 도입 확대, 멀티 드론 협업 알고리즘의 개발, 군용 및 국방 분야에서의 군집 드론 운용에 대한 관심 증가, 소형 센서 및 통신 하드웨어의 개선 등을 꼽을 수 있습니다.

드론 군집 통신 모듈 모듈 시장 규모는 향후 수년간 급성장이 전망되고 있습니다. 2030년에는 33억 5,000만 달러에 달하며, CAGR은 18.3%에 달할 전망입니다. 예측 기간 중 이러한 성장은 AI 기반 자율 군집 제어 시스템의 채택 확대, 협동 드론 운영의 상용 용도 확대, 고속 연결을 위한 5G 및 Beyond 5G 무선 기술의 통합, 클라우드 기반 드론 데이터 관리에 대한 투자 증가, 시스템 신뢰성 향상을 위한 드론 제조업체와 통신 모듈 프로바이더 간의 협력 등에 기인한다고 볼 수 있습니다. 예측 기간 중 주요 동향으로는 드론 군집에서 장애에 강한 멀티노드 메시 네트워킹에 대한 수요 증가, 협동 임무를 위한 고 대역폭 및 저 지연 통신 모듈의 빠른 통합, 실시간 군집 시뮬레이션 및 훈련 플랫폼의 확대, 유연한 군집 구성을 위한 모듈형 통신 하드웨어 채택 확대, 안전한 드론 협동 운용을 지원하는 암호화 통신 시스템의 성장 등을 꼽을 수 있습니다. 실시간 군집 시뮬레이션 및 훈련 플랫폼의 확대, 유연한 군집 구성을 위한 모듈형 통신 하드웨어의 채택 확대, 안전한 드론 협동 운용을 지원하는 암호화 통신 시스템의 성장 등을 들 수 있습니다.

첨단 통신 모듈의 채택 확대는 향후 드론 웜 통신 모듈 시장의 성장을 촉진할 것으로 예측됩니다. 고급 통신 모듈은 연결된 장치와 네트워크 간에 빠르고 안정적인 지능형 데이터 전송을 가능하게 하는 하드웨어와 소프트웨어의 통합 구성요소를 말합니다. 효율적인 데이터 전송과 복잡한 용도를 지원하는 더 빠르고 안정적인 연결성에 대한 수요가 증가함에 따라 고급 통신 모듈의 채택이 증가하고 있습니다. 드론 스웜 통신 모듈은 실시간 멀티 드론 협업을 위한 안정적인 고속 연결을 보장하여 고급 통신 모듈을 지원합니다. 예를 들어 2023년 12월 영국 정부 기관인 통신국(Office of Communications)은 2023년 영국에서 약 81,000개 지점에서 1만 8,500건 이상의 5G 도입이 기록될 것이라고 보고했습니다. 이는 2022년에 보고된 약 1만 2,000건의 도입 건수보다 증가한 수치입니다. 따라서 첨단 통신 모듈의 채택 확대가 드론 및 드론 군집 통신 모듈 시장의 성장을 촉진하고 있습니다.

드론 군집 통신 모듈 분야의 각 업체들은 안전하고 협동적인 드론 운용을 보장하기 위해 전자전에 대한 내성 등의 기능을 포함한 기술 혁신에 집중하고 있습니다. 이 내성은 재밍이나 간섭과 같은 전자적 위협에 직면했을 때에도 시스템이 안정적인 기능과 통신을 유지할 수 있는 능력을 의미합니다. 예를 들어 2024년 7월, 자율 로봇용 운영체제 및 소프트웨어를 제공하는 미국 기업 Auterion Inc.는 군용 드론을 위해 설계된 종합적인 온보드 컴퓨터 겸 비행 컨트롤러인 'Skynode S'를 발표했습니다. 이 새로운 시스템은 국방수권법(NDAA)을 준수하고, 저비용 군집 관리를 지원하며, 완전 자율 비행을 가능하게 합니다. 또한 다양한 상용 및 국방 시스템과 쉽게 통합할 수 있으며, 이미 실전에서 검증된 첨단 컴퓨터 비전 및 표적 포착 기능을 제공하여 현대전에서 대규모 드론 운용을 혁신하는 기술로 자리매김하고 있습니다.

A drone swarm communication module is a specialized system that enables smooth data exchange and coordination among multiple drones operating in unison. It delivers low-latency, high-bandwidth connections that facilitate real-time sharing of positional, sensor, and control data to maintain synchronized flight formations. By ensuring reliable connectivity, it allows swarms to carry out complex collaborative missions such as surveillance, mapping, and search operations with efficiency.

The primary components of a drone swarm communication module are hardware, software, and services. Hardware consists of the physical elements devices, equipment, and machinery that support system functionality. Communication technologies include radio frequency, optical, satellite, cellular, and others, while platforms range across commercial, military, industrial drones, and more. Key applications include surveillance and monitoring, search and rescue, agriculture, delivery and logistics, defense, and others. End-users span sectors such as defense and security, agriculture, logistics, industry, and beyond.

Tariffs are elevating production costs in the drone swarm communication module market by raising prices of semiconductor components, RF chips, antennas, processors, and navigation modules sourced from global suppliers. These impacts are most significant across hardware and communication technology segments, particularly in regions such as North America and Asia-Pacific where manufacturing and assembly heavily depend on imported electronic parts. Increased costs are slowing adoption in commercial, industrial, and defense drone programs, however, tariffs are also driving domestic component manufacturing and encouraging localized supply chains that may benefit long-term market resilience.

The drone swarm communication module market size has grown rapidly in recent years. It will grow from $1.44 billion in 2025 to $1.71 billion in 2026 at a compound annual growth rate (CAGR) of 18.8%. The growth in the historic period can be attributed to advancements in low-latency wireless communication technologies, increasing deployment of drones for surveillance and mapping applications, development of multi-drone coordination algorithms, rising military and defense interest in swarm drone operations, improvements in miniaturized sensors and communication hardware.

The drone swarm communication module market size is expected to see rapid growth in the next few years. It will grow to $3.35 billion in 2030 at a compound annual growth rate (CAGR) of 18.3%. The growth in the forecast period can be attributed to growing adoption of AI-driven autonomous swarm control systems, expansion of commercial applications for coordinated drone operations, integration of 5g and beyond wireless technologies for high-speed connectivity, increasing investments in cloud-based drone data management, collaborations between drone manufacturers and communication module providers for enhanced system reliability. Major trends in the forecast period include increasing demand for resilient multi-node mesh networking in drone swarms, rapid integration of high-bandwidth, low-latency communication modules for coordinated missions, expansion of real-time swarm simulation and training platforms, rising adoption of modular communication hardware for flexible swarm configurations, growth in encrypted communication systems to support secure coordinated drone operations.

The increasing adoption of advanced communication modules is expected to propel the growth of the drone swarm communication module market going forward. Advanced communication modules refer to integrated hardware and software components that enable high-speed, reliable, and intelligent data transmission across connected devices and networks. Adoption of advanced communication modules is rising due to growing demand for faster, more dependable connectivity that supports efficient data transfer and complex applications. The drone swarm communication module supports advanced communication modules by ensuring reliable, high-speed connectivity for real-time multi-drone coordination. For instance, in December 2023, the Office of Communications, a UK-based government agency, reported that in 2023, the UK recorded over 18,500 5G deployments across approximately 81,000 sites, up from around 12,000 deployments reported in 2022. Therefore, the increasing adoption of advanced communication modules is driving the growth of the drone swarm communication module market.

Companies in the drone swarm communication module sector are emphasizing technological innovation, including features such as resilience against electronic warfare, to ensure secure and coordinated drone operations. This resilience refers to a system's ability to maintain dependable functionality and communication even when facing electronic threats such as jamming or interference. For instance, in July 2024, Auterion Inc., a US-based provider of operating systems and software for autonomous robotics, introduced Skynode S, a comprehensive onboard computer and flight controller designed for military drones. This new system is compliant with the National Defense Authorization Act (NDAA), supports low-cost swarm management, and enables fully autonomous flights. It also integrates easily with a variety of commercial and defense systems while offering advanced computer vision and targeting features already tested in combat, positioning it as a game-changing technology for large-scale drone operations in modern warfare.

In May 2025, AeroVironment Inc., a US-based producer of multi-domain robotic systems, completed the acquisition of BlueHalo for $4.1 billion. This acquisition allows AeroVironment to incorporate BlueHalo's cutting-edge directed energy and next-generation communication technologies into its own unmanned and space-based platforms. The integration enhances AeroVironment's ability to deliver defense solutions that span multiple domains, including air, land, sea, space, and cyber. BlueHalo LLC, also based in the United States, specializes in the development of advanced drone swarm and communication technologies, particularly for military use.
